WebWholemeal flour is healthier as it’s higher in fibre so it can help with gut and heart health. It's also more filling, so a smaller portion will keep you fuller for longer. It works in most recipes, but if you find it a bit heavy for things like sponge cakes, try using a ratio of 30:70 or 50:50 wholemeal flour to plain flour.

Psyllium Husk is the most known fiber used in Keto cooking and baking. Although psyllium husk is not flour, it is a great addition to any low carb pantry.
